On Sat, 7 Jul 2007 00:12:32 +0200 Andreas 'ads' Scherbaum wrote: > On Fri, 6 Jul 2007 12:06:41 -0400 Alvaro Herrera wrote: > > > Andreas 'ads' Scherbaum wrote: > > > The value is '0' for all columns in all entries, except 'vacrelid' and 'enabled'. > > > Can a VACUUM run happen, even if enabled is set to false? > > > > Huh, try putting -1 in all columns instead. 0 is a nasty value to have > > in there. I haven't tested the effects but if freeze_max_age is 0 it > > may be doing what Pavan says. > > Ok, did this. Will take a look, what autovacuum is doing now. Seems like that was the problem. I changed all '0' to '-1' and VACUUM is skipping this tables now. Thanks for finding this out -- Andreas 'ads' Scherbaum Failure is not an option. It comes bundled with your Microsoft product.
